The Dynamites featuring Charles Walker - Beck's Festival Bar
With I Like It Like That Orchestra & Russ Dewbury (Jazz Rooms)
Old school soul performer, Charles Walker, cut his teeth in New York's legendary Apollo Theatre in its 1960s heyday, opening for the likes of James Brown, Etta James and Wilson Pickett.
Now at the helm of Nashville's The Dynamites, the band fuses old and new to create irresistibly fresh funk and soul music with the authenticity of the great bands of the 60s. On stage, the band cuts a dashing sight with slick suits and suave moves. Expect an exhilarating live show to open the Beck's Festival Bar proceedings.
The eleven piece, I Like It Like That Orchestra featuring guest vocalists Eddie Ignacio, Carlos Velazquez and Merenia Gillies, will conquer the dance floor with an explosive set of Brazilian beats, Latin soul and funk. Be it 1970's Rio, Havana or New York, or Sydney in 2011 this collective will deliver the full Latin heat.
